Abstract

Abstract

En 中文
Multiple Input Multiple Output (MIMO) is the key techniques to achieve high throughput for 3GPP Long Term Evaluation (LTE). In the downlink, the number of the receive antennas is limited by the weight, size and battery consumption requirements of the mobile terminal. Using multiple receive antennas will obviously be a limiting factor in the development of small terminals. In this paper, we propose a Spatial Temporal Turbo Channel Coding scheme for 3GPP LTE to achieve both high data rate and performance. The advantage of the technique is that it is effective with a small number of receive antennas, including the case of only one receive antenna.
